- Description
- Twenty six unidentified women at a social gathering, probably the Art Study Club organized in Chattanooga, Tennessee in 1909. Possible identifications include: Mrs. Garnet Carter (Frieda) in the wheelchair; Mrs. W. G. Oehmig, Jr. seated on the far left; Mrs. James Finley (Cora) in the back row 3rd from left; Mrs. Jennie Carswell Elliott standing behind the seated woman in polka dots; and Mary Bashie Lindsay standing first from the right.
